Method

Preparation and Cooking Instructions

  1. 1

    Prepare the Filling

    In a large mixing bowl, combine ground chicken, finely chopped leeks, minced ginger, minced garlic, soy sauce, sesame oil, salt, and black pepper. Mix well until all ingredients are fully integrated.

  2. 2

    Assemble the Gyoza

    Take a gyoza wrapper and place about 1 tablespoon of the filling in the center. Moisten the edges of the wrapper with water using your finger. Fold the wrapper in half to create a crescent shape and pinch the edges to seal. Create pleats along the sealed edge for a decorative touch. Repeat until all filling is used.

  3. 3

    Cook the Gyoza

    Heat a non-stick skillet over medium heat and add a small amount of oil. Once hot, add the gyoza in a single layer and cook for about 2-3 minutes until the bottoms are golden brown. Carefully add 100 ml of water to the skillet and cover immediately. Steam the gyoza for about 5-7 minutes, or until the water has evaporated and the gyoza are cooked through.

  4. 4

    Serve

    Remove the lid and let the gyoza cook for an additional minute to crisp up the bottoms. Serve hot with housemade gyoza sauce.
